Meaning of Butiner – French Verb

Butiner means to forage or gather nectar, as bees do.

Examples of butiner in Every Day Usage

  1. Les abeilles butinent les fleurs pour collecter du pollen. (The bees are foraging on the flowers to collect pollen.)
  2. Les papillons butinent sur les plantes pour se nourrir de nectar. (The butterflies are flitting around on the plants to feed on nectar.)
  3. Elle aime butiner dans les magasins pour trouver des bonnes affaires. (She enjoys browsing in stores to find good deals.)
